About the Role
We are seeking a Construction Quality Inspector to join a leading main contractor working on multiple education and residential projects in Dublin and Wicklow. This role offers a rewarding opportunity for junior to intermediate level professionals to contribute to ensuring construction quality standards are consistently met.
Key Responsibilities
- Implement and monitor adherence to the Project Quality Plan (PQP) throughout the construction phases.
- Maintain accurate records of all inspections and tests in compliance with quality assurance procedures.
- Oversee material deliveries and conduct on-site testing such as concrete cube testing and soil compaction analysis.
- Coordinate with third-party inspectors and testing agencies to ensure project compliance.
- Perform regular quality inspections to verify work aligns with project specifications and building regulations.
- Manage Non-Conformance Reports (NCRs) and track corrective actions to completion.
- Communicate and collaborate with Assigned and Design Certifiers to ensure project standards.
- Assist the Site Manager in preparing QA documentation and ensuring overall project compliance.
- Validate as-built drawings, Operations & Maintenance manuals, and certification packages before project handover.
- Utilize software tools such as OBI and ArtechPro to coordinate quality assurance activities with client representatives on site.
Candidate Profile and Requirements
This position is suitable for construction professionals at a junior or intermediate stage, eager to advance their career in construction quality management on significant projects. Practical experience or knowledge in site quality inspection practices, familiarity with construction quality standards, and ability to manage compliance documentation are essential.
